How much do customer service advisor j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for customer service advisor in Arizona is $19.33,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.33 and $22.16 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a customer service advisor?

A customer service advisor is the main point of contact for customers who call the customer service phone number or online chat application of a business or company. Their primary job duties are communicating with customers and resolving their issues. Other responsibilities may include answering general questions, collecting feedback about customers’ experience, placing and tracking orders, explaining services, initiating or canceling service contracts, troubleshooting problems, and fielding complaints. The main objective of a customer service advisor is to offer attention to your business’s customers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a customer service advisor?

To thrive as a Customer Service Advisor, you need excellent communication skills, problem-solving abilities, and typically at least a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software, call center systems, and basic office applications is often required. Patience, active listening, and a positive attitude are standout soft skills in this role. These competencies are crucial for resolving customer issues efficiently, maintaining satisfaction, and supporting a positive brand reputation.

How does a customer service advisor typically handle challenging customer interactions, and what support is available from the team?

Customer Service Advisors frequently encounter challenging interactions, such as resolving complaints or managing dissatisfied customers. Most organizations provide advisors with training in de-escalation techniques and access to knowledge bases or escalation paths for complex issues. Team leads and supervisors are typically available for support, and regular team meetings or debriefs help share strategies and experiences. Collaboration with colleagues is encouraged to ensure consistent service and emotional support during demanding situations.

Is a customer service advisor a good entry level job?

A customer service advisor role is often considered a good entry-level job because it requires minimal prior experience and helps develop communication, problem-solving, and interpersonal skills. It typically involves working in a fast-paced environment, using tools like CRM software, and may lead to advancement within customer support or other departments.

What skills do you need to be a customer service advisor?

A customer service advisor needs strong communication skills, problem-solving abilities, and patience to handle customer inquiries effectively. They should be proficient in using computer systems and customer service software, and often require good interpersonal skills to maintain positive interactions with customers.

Valvoline Inc., headquartered in Lexington, Kentucky, US, is an international manufacturer and distributor of automotive oil, additives, and lubricants. Established in 1866 by Dr. John Ellis, Valvoline is recognized as the creator of the world's first high mileage motor oil, advancing as a leader in the automotive lubricant industry ever since. The company's product portfolio incorporates a vast range of motor and industrial oils, lubricants, and automotive maintenance goods.
